Captures make Armed Forces proud and make Colombians feel calmed

President Álvaro Uribe Vélez pointed today that recent detentions of dangerous criminals encourage the Armed Forces to keep fighting to stop crime and be able to give the new generations a peaceful country.

Bogotá, April 16 (SP). President Álvaro Uribe declared today that recent captures must make soldiers and policemen proud and give tranquility to all Colombians.

“I would like to say the following about recent captures: this captures must make all members of the Colombian Army Forces proud, every one of our policemen and soldiers, and also make Colombian people to feel calmed and proud”, said the leader at a press conference at the Casa de Nariño in which he announced some learning contracts with Darío Montoya, Director of SENA.

Uribe Vélez highlighted that “these captures encourage our soldiers and policemen to keep moving on, to finish with crime and be able to give new generations a country where they can live in peace, live happy”.

The National Police captured Daniel Rendón Herrera aka ‘Don Mario’ at Necoclí (Antioquia) on Wednesday, April 15, one of the most important leaders of criminal bands of the zone and one of the most wanted drug traffickers of the country.

Three alleged criminals were also captured in Medellín, including José Leonardo Muñoz aka ‘Douglas’, considered one of the leaders of the crime organization known as ‘La Oficina de Envigado’ (Envigado’s Office).
